News comes to the fore that England’s white-ball captain Jos Buttler is being offered a landmark four-year deal by IPL franchise Rajasthan Royals.
In close proximity the T20 format is growing at a rapid pace as almost every cricket-playing nation has started its marquee T20 competition.
With the addition of new leagues, IPL owners have expanded their dominance, as they now own several franchises in these budding leagues.
By dint of the expansion, the IPL owners have endeavoured to rope in players to play for all their global franchises for which they have prepared contracts that ask the players to play for all their extended teams across leagues and give up their national contract.
As of now, Jos plays for RR in IPL and Paarl Royals in SA20 but does not play for Barbados Royals in the CPL.
By inking the deal, Buttler would have to give up on his international contract and seek RR management’s permission to play white-ball cricket for
The Three Lions.
He has been reportedly offered INR 40 crore for 4 years.
Apart from Buttler, MI were also reported to present a similar proposition to Jofra Archer, while Jason Roy recently gave up his contract to sign a deal with KKR and will be next seen in the upcoming Major League Cricket (MLC) playing for LA Knight Riders.
